How to Get Fleas Out of a Car?

Transporting a pet infested with fleas can rapidly turn your vehicle's carpet, floor mats, and fabric upholstery into a thriving breeding ground for adult fleas, microscopic eggs, larvae, and pupae. Because a car interior features warm, dark crevices between seat cushions and beneath floor tracks, fleas can survive for weeks without a host. Eradicating a vehicular flea infestation requires breaking the four-stage parasitic life cycle through high-powered HEPA vacuuming, botanical desiccant powders, thermal steam extraction, and insect growth regulators (IGRs).

The Flea Lifecycle and Vulnerable Automotive Hotspots

To permanently eliminate fleas from a car, one must recognize that visible adult biting fleas represent merely 5% of the total vehicular infestation. The remaining 95% consists of invisible eggs (50%), worm-like larvae (35%), and cocooned pupae (10%) that hide deep within the weave of automotive upholstery and under carpet fibers. When a pet scratches during a car ride, hundreds of flea eggs roll off into seat seams, seatbelt crevices, and under seat tracks.

Flea pupae pose the greatest challenge in an automobile. Protected by a sticky silk-like cocoon that repels standard aerosol insect sprays, pupae can remain dormant for up to six months, emerging only when stimulated by the heat, vibrations, and carbon dioxide produced by human occupants. Therefore, a single spray application is insufficient; eradication demands continuous physical extraction and chemical disruption of the reproductive cycle.

Mechanical Vacuuming and Thermal Steam Cleaning Protocols

The foundation of automotive flea eradication begins with rigorous mechanical removal. Remove all detachable components from the vehicle, including floor mats, child safety seats, trunk liners, and seat covers. Wash all washable fabric covers in hot water (exceeding 130 degrees Fahrenheit) and dry on high heat for at least thirty minutes to kill all life stages.

Using a high-powered shop vacuum or commercial car wash vacuum equipped with a crevice tool, meticulously vacuum every square inch of the vehicle interior. Pay special attention to seat crevices where backrests meet bottom cushions, carpet fibers underneath front seats, seatbelt retractor wells, and trunk spare tire compartments. The mechanical suction of a vacuum immediately removes eggs and larvae, while the physical vibrations trigger dormant pupae to hatch, exposing them to subsequent treatments. Empty the vacuum canister or bag into an outdoor trash bin immediately.

Applying Insect Growth Regulators (IGRs) and Natural Desiccants

To neutralize microscopic eggs and larvae missed by vacuuming, apply an automotive-safe treatment. Food-grade diatomaceous earth (DE) provides a natural, non-toxic desiccant option. Dust a fine, thin layer of DE across car carpets and fabric floorboards using a powder duster. The microscopic silica particles slice through the waxy protective cuticle of fleas and larvae, causing them to dehydrate and die within 24 to 48 hours. Vacuum up the powder thoroughly after two days.

For severe infestations, treat vehicle fabrics with an aerosol spray containing an Insect Growth Regulator (IGR) such as pyriproxyfen or methoprene (found in veterinary premises sprays like Virbac Knockout or Ultracide). IGRs mimic juvenile growth hormones, sterilizing adult female fleas and preventing newly hatched larvae from molting into biting adults for up to seven months. Roll down car windows to ventilate the cabin thoroughly until fabrics are completely dry before driving.

How to Eradicate Fleas from Your Car in 5 Steps

Follow these five pest-control steps to eliminate all flea life stages from your vehicle interior.

  1. Remove and Wash Detachable Fabrics

    Take out floor mats, seat covers, and blankets, washing them in hot water and drying on high heat.

  2. Vacuum Deep into Seams and Floorboards

    Use a crevice attachment to vacuum seat folds, under pedals, carpet seams, and trunk spaces thoroughly.

  3. Deploy Thermal Steam Cleaning

    Run a commercial steam cleaner emitting 200°F steam over fabric seats and carpets to kill eggs and pupae.

  4. Apply an Insect Growth Regulator (IGR)

    Mist carpets and lower upholstery with a vehicle-safe IGR spray to stop the reproductive cycle.

  5. Treat Your Pet Concurrently

    Administer a vet-approved oral or topical flea treatment to your pet to prevent re-infestation of the vehicle.

Frequently Asked Questions (8 Questions Answered)

Q1: Can fleas live in a hot car during the summer?

Yes, although temperatures above 100°F can kill fleas, fleas burrow into shaded, cooler floorboards and seat seams where temperatures remain survivable.

Q2: How long can fleas live in a car without a dog?

Adult fleas starve within two weeks without a blood host, but cocooned pupae can remain dormant inside vehicle carpets for up to six months.

Q3: Can you set off a flea fogger inside a car?

Using a household flea fogger (bug bomb) in a car is not recommended; it leaves dangerous, sticky pesticide residue across steering wheels and glass.

Q4: Is food-grade diatomaceous earth safe for car upholstery?

Yes, food-grade diatomaceous earth is non-toxic to humans and pets, but wear a mask during application to avoid breathing fine dust.

Q5: Do fleas bite humans in cars?

Yes, hungry fleas trapped in a vehicle will readily bite human ankles, legs, and wrists, leaving itchy red welts.

Q6: Does steam cleaning a car kill fleas?

Yes, commercial steam cleaners producing temperatures exceeding 140°F kill adult fleas, larvae, and eggs instantly on contact.

Q7: Can fleas survive on leather car seats?

While fleas cannot burrow into smooth leather, they hide in the stitching seams, perforations, and adjacent floor carpeting.

Q8: Why do fleas keep coming back in my car?

Recurring infestations occur when dormant pupae hatch weeks later, or when an untreated pet continuously reintroduces new fleas into the car.
